:root{
  --wccm: #be1038;
  --background:#c0392b;
/*    
  --wccm: #6C7C69; 
  --background:#e3c196;
*/
  
}


#logo,#top {
background-color: var(--wccm);
/*background-color: black;*/
}

#logo {padding-bottom: 10px; }

header#header {
background: var(--wccm);
/*background: black;*/
}

div.search {
  float: right !important;
}
.navbar-inverse .brand, .navbar-inverse .nav > li > a {
  font-family: Verdana !important;
/*    letter-spacing: 1px;*/
}
section div#above-content {
  margin-bottom: -30px !important;
}
font-weight: bold !important; 
h1 {
text-decoration: none !important;
font-family: Verdana,Geneva,Tahoma,Arial,sans-serif !important; 
font-size: 160% !important;
color: var(--wccm) !important;
margin-bottom: 6pt;
margin-top: 0;
}
h2 {
text-decoration: none !important;
font-family: Verdana,Geneva,Tahoma,Arial,sans-serif !important; 
font-size: 125% !important;
font-weight: bold !important; 
color: var(--wccm) !important;
margin-bottom: 6pt;
margin-top: 0;
}
h2 a {
text-decoration: none !important; 
font-size: 125%;
font-family: Verdana,Geneva,Tahoma,Arial,sans-serif !important;
font-weight: bold;
color: var(--wccm) !important;
margin-bottom: 6pt;
margin-top: 0;
}
h3 {
text-decoration: none !important;
font-family: Verdana,Geneva,Tahoma,Arial,sans-serif !important; 
font-size: 110% !important;
font-weight: bold !important; 
color: var(--wccm) !important;
margin-bottom: 6pt;
margin-top: 0;
}
#main h1,#main h2,#main h4,#main h5,#main h6,
h1 a, h2 a, h3 a, h4 a, h5 a, h6 a{
  font-weight: normal;
  font-family: Verdana,Geneva,Tahoma,Arial,sans-serif;  
  color:black;
  margin-top: 6pt;
}
#jevents_header h1,#jevents_body h1, #page-header {
  margin-top: 24pt;
  font-size: 100%;!important;
}
.acesearch_input_module_simple, #qr-99.acesearch_input_module_simple {
  font-family: Verdana,Geneva,Tahoma,Arial,sans-serif;
  font-size: 80%;!important;
}
#radiusSelect, #featstate, #catid, #sl_search_address, #sl_search_radiusSelect, .buttonlink_small, #addressInput, input.btn, input.inputbox {
  font-family: Verdana,Geneva,Tahoma,Arial,sans-serif;
  font-size: 80%;!important;
}
#sl_search_container, {
  margin-top: 24pt;
  font-size: 80%;!important;
}
#locate_form h3 {
    font-family: Verdana,Geneva,Tahoma,Arial,sans-serif;
  font-size: 100%;!important;
}
.rapid_contact_ex.inputbox, .rapid_contact_ex.button , .rapid_contact_ex.textarea{
font-family: Verdana,Geneva,Tahoma,Arial,sans-serif;
  font-size: 80%;!important;
}
#jevents_header.contentpaneopen.jeventpage {
  margin-top: 24pt;
}
ul.actions {
  margin-top: 36pt;
}
.wrapper-footer {
padding-top: 0px;
}
.wrapper-toolbar {
padding-bottom: 6px;
}
.page-header h1 {  
  font-size: 100%;!important;
}
.fontsmaller {  
  font-size: 11pt;!important;
}
.acesearch_suggestions{
	height: 70pt;
}
div#grid-top{
  	height: 30px;
}
section#main.span9{
  	padding-top: 0px;
}
div.module.mod_1.first.last.no_title.span12{
  	margin-bottom: 0px;
}
td.rpx_tablecell{
  width: 500px;
}
div#featureCarousel141{
  background-color: #FFFFFF;
}
#main h1,#main h2,#main h4,#main h5,#main h6,
h1 a, h2 a, h3 a, h4 a, h5 a, h6 a{
  color:#a54231;
  font-weight: bold;
}
h1 {
text-decoration: none !important;
font-family: Verdana,Geneva,Tahoma,Arial,sans-serif !important; 
font-size: 150% !important;
color: var(--wccm) !important;
margin-bottom: 6pt;
margin-top: 6pt;
}

.navbar-inner{background-color:var(--wccm);}


.sb2 #sidebar2{background-color:#fff;}

.mod_events_latest, .mod_events_latest_date, .mod_events_latest_content{color:#444752;}

div.container-fluid.container-alasse{background-color:#fff;}
div.container-fluid.footer-content.container-alasse{background-color:var(--wccm);}
.alasse-toolbar-container{background-color:var(--wccm);}
.wrappToolbar{background-color:var(--wccm);}
#footer{border-top-color:var(--wccm);}
.wrapper-bottom-menu{background-color:var(--wccm);}


#radiusSelect select { background-color: #000; color: #fff; opacity:1;}

#sl_search_container input[type="text"] { background-color: #aaa; color: #fff;}
#sl_search_container select { background-color: #aaa; color: #fff;}
#sl_search_container select option{ background-color: #888; color: #fff;}
#sl_search_container select { padding: 0 0;}
#sl_search_container input[type="text"] { padding: 0 5px; min-height: 30px;}
#sl_search_container select[id="catid"] { padding: 0 5px; min-height: 30px;}

#extra { background: #fff;}
.slide-desc-bg-default { background: rgba(0, 0, 0, 0.0) !important;}
.slide-desc-text-default a.readmore {color: #fff;}

div.newssldr .slide-desc-bg-default { background: rgba(190, 16, 56, 0.85) !important;}
#slider174 > li {border: 2px solid var(--wccm) !important;}
#djslider174  {margin-bottom: 40px !important;}

#footer .footer-content a {color: #e2f825;}

.navbar-inverse .nav>.active>a,
.navbar-inverse .nav>.active>a:hover,
.navbar-inverse .nav>.active>a:focus {
 color:#fff;
/* background-color:#c0392b */
 background-color:var(--background )
}

/*

.navbar .nav>li>.dropdown-menu>li:hover>a {
 background-color: var(--background )
}
.navbar .nav>li>.dropdown-menu>li .sub-menu {
 background-color:var(--background )
}
.navbar .nav>li>.dropdown-menu>li .sub-menu>li.active>a {
 background-color:var(--background )
}
.navbar .nav>li>.dropdown-menu>li .sub-menu>li:hover>a {
 background-color:var(--background )
}

*/
